Valoctocogene roxaparvovec
Approved medicineAlso known as Roctavian, DNA (synthetic adeno-associated virus 5 vector BMN 270 human blood-coagulation factor VIII SQ variant-specifying).

Treatment of severe haemophilia A (congenital factor VIII deficiency) in adult patients without a history of factor VIII inhibitors and without detectable antibodies to adeno-associated virus serotype 5 (AAV5).
